Eternal Balance
A bottle opener that reimagines what it means to be sustainable.
When we think of sustainability, we all imagine recycling, clean water and air, and consuming less energy. What we do not imagine is fire, disease, and death. However, these both play a role in maintaining homeostasis and balance in life. Forest fires are a natural part of reinvigorating and renewing the land, just as rain is needed to contain these fires and give life.
This project was meant to reflect how we need both life and death, growth and decay, and fire and water to maintain life as we know. I wanted to convey that sustainability is an eternal balance between these forces. This is achieved by having on each end of the bottom opener a wave to represent water, and a flame to represent fire, connected in an infinity symbol. I designed the opener with surface modeling before generating the CAM in HSMWorks. The opener was machined out of brass to give it a good weight and patina as it ages. Processes: sketching, laser cutting, 3D printing, 3D modeling, CAM, CNC machining, finishing
